The reason with the bend stick is due to goat pores and skin. This is certainly skinny like eighty-100gsm paper, Therefore the adhere must be bent to prevent piercing the pores and skin. The bass adhere or Dagga would be the thicker of The 2 and is particularly bent in an eighth- or quarter-round arc on the end that strikes the instrument.[two] The other stick, called the teeli, is much thinner and versatile and used to Enjoy the higher Be aware end with the instrument.[3]
Contemporary tassa drums are created by reducing an vacant coolant tank or buoy in fifty percent and attaching a artificial drum skin to the best of it with nuts and bolts, welding it shut. Synthetic drums do past for a longer period and don't have to be modified as routinely. Whilst artificial drums final more time, they deviate through the long-standing tradition of clay and goatskin and, according to some connoisseurs and aficionados, will not audio also due to its confined variety of pitch and cold, metallic, twangy tones.
